MarksNelson employees knit scarves for homeless

A group of MarksNelson employees knitted hats and scarves for the homeless on Thursday. It’s part of the “Wrapped in Warmth” campaign, where these clothing accessories will be spread throughout Washington Square Park for people who are homeless.
